The Master Clock: Understanding Your Circadian Rhythm

The human body operates on an intricate 24-hour cycle known as the circadian rhythm. This internal clock governs crucial physiological processes, including sleep-wake cycles, hormone production, metabolism, and mood. Ideally, it aligns seamlessly with the natural cycle of day and night, promoting alertness during the day and restful recovery at night.

However, modern lifestyles are significant disruptors. Constant exposure to artificial light (especially blue light from screens), irregular work schedules, chronic stress, suboptimal diet, and insufficient natural light exposure can throw this delicate rhythm into disarray. When the circadian clock is misaligned, the body struggles to perform essential functions optimally. This imbalance extends beyond mere fatigue, impacting critical hormonal systems like cortisol levels, testosterone production, and growth hormone release, as well as immune response. For men, this can manifest as reduced stamina, difficulty concentrating, lower libido, and a general lack of motivation.

Mainstream approaches often overlook this foundational issue, focusing on isolated symptoms. A significant meta-analysis published in the journal Sleep Medicine Reviews found a strong correlation between circadian disruption and a range of health issues, including metabolic syndrome, mood disorders, and impaired male reproductive health. A compromised internal clock can undermine numerous systems vital for overall well-being.

Magnesium and Zinc: Architects of Energy and Male Vitality

Magnesium, often referred to as "nature's tranquilizer," plays a critical role in calming the nervous system. It binds to GABA receptors, which help quiet brain activity, thereby facilitating easier sleep onset and improved sleep continuity. Furthermore, magnesium is essential for the production of melatonin, the "sleep hormone," ensuring its timely release and robust impact. By supporting deep, restorative sleep, magnesium directly aids the healthy function of the circadian rhythm, preparing the body for optimal energy and hormone production during the day.

Zinc, on the other hand, is a cornerstone of male hormonal health. It is indispensable for the enzymatic processes involved in testosterone conversion and is crucial for maintaining healthy levels of this vital hormone. Beyond its direct impact on libido and muscle strength, optimal testosterone levels contribute significantly to stable mood, sustained energy, and mental sharpness throughout the day. When both magnesium and zinc levels are optimized, they create a synergistic effect: magnesium ensures the body can properly rest and repair, while zinc helps regulate the hormonal landscape that dictates male vitality. This allows the circadian rhythm to operate smoothly, powering performance from morning to night.
